Date: | Wednesday 8 December 2010 |
Time: | 11:30 |
Type: | Piper PA-31-350 Navajo Chieftan |
Owner/operator: | Tas-Air Pty Ltd |
Registration: | VH-JVD |
MSN: | 31-7852041 |
Year of manufacture: | 1978 |
Fatalities: | Fatalities: 0 / Occupants: 8 |
Other fatalities: | 0 |
Aircraft damage: | Substantial |
Location: | King Island Airport, King Island, TAS -
Australia
|
Phase: | Landing |
Nature: | Passenger - Non-Scheduled/charter/Air Taxi |
Departure airport: | Devonport Airport, TAS (DPO/YDPO) |
Destination airport: | King Island Airport, TAS (KNS/YKII) |
Confidence Rating: | Information verified through data from accident investigation authorities |
Narrative:Pilot 'forgot' to lower the gear - damage associated with a gear up landing - bent props and fuselage damage. No injuries (except pride)! Unconfirmed as 1 pilot and 7 passengers.
